Choose solar-powered lights when installing outdoor lighting in your yard. These lamps are cheap and don’t require any power besides sun exposure. This saves you a lot of energy. It also means you don’t need to wire your outdoor lights.
Maintaining your refrigerator is an easy way to save energy. Since refrigerators are one of the high-consumption appliances, it’s crucial that you keep it running efficiently. Regularly make sure the heating coils are dust-free. Also, check the door to be sure it is sealed tightly.
Dressing in warm attire can be a great way to cut energy costs while embracing green energy. A light sweater offers 2 degrees of more warmth, and a heavy sweater adds 4 degrees. It’s not necessary to wear so little at home, so out on a sweatshirt and save some cash!

A laptop is actually a great alternative for consuming less energy as opposed to using a desktop. Making this switch can reduce your power consumption by up to 75%. This is especially true if you are an Internet addict or do heavy word processing. Since laptops are portable, you can use them anywhere.
Hire experts to check your plumbing and heating systems before investing a lot of money in installing new, greener systems. You can be shown where your money is being lost through inefficient products, and some great estimates on upgrades or replacements.

You might not have the money to invest in a solar panel array, but you can commit to cleaning your furnace filters once per month and setting your thermostat to 60 degrees while you are out. Setting your water heater to 120 F will also be an energy saver. Even the smallest amount of effort can help.
You can actually use biofuels to add heat for your home. Bio-fuels consist of vegetable fat, animal fat, oils and wood. Typically, if your furnace uses propane, professionals can easily provide changes so you use these fuels. This fuel would contain anywhere from 20-99% biodiesel. Always speak with a professional who will guide you in how to properly use this type of fuel.
Share rides with others in your neighborhood to greatly reduce your fuel usage. If you are a parent, carpool with other adults. If you live close to family or friends, carpool for grocery shopping or other errands to save gas.
Use the microwave as much as you can to save energy while cooking. When cooking in the oven or on the stove, it tends to burn up a lot more energy. So, never shy away from the microwave when using it is an option. You will save time, money, and energy by making this choice.
Consider replacing your wooden products with bamboo when buying new. Bamboo serves as a green replacement for wood. Though it is a grass, it has much more strength and durability than many commercial woods. Many items are now available in bamboo. Try bamboo in your flooring, utensils, or cutting surfaces instead of traditional woods. The products are more affordable due to a reduction in the cost of manufacturing products.
Solar panels can be added to your home as an easy green energy source. This can be a costly option in the beginning but it will pay great economic and environmental dividends over time. Once the panels are in, solar power is free; you might even be able to sell power to local utility companies.
